פיתוח REST API מקצועי. אנו בונים RESTful APIs עם תכנון משאבים נכון, אימות, חלוקה לעמודים (pagination), ניהול גרסאות ותיעוד מקיף.
התחילו
REST נשאר הסטנדרט עבור web APIs — אך REST APIs רבים מעוצבים בצורה גרועה, לא עקביים וקשים לשימוש. אנו בונים REST APIs העוקבים אחר שיטות עבודה מומלצות: מבני URL צפויים, שיטות HTTP נכונות, תגובות שגיאה עקביות, חלוקה יעילה לעמודים (pagination), ותיעוד שמפתחים באמת רוצים לקרוא.
אנו בונים REST APIs עם Express, Fastify, או NestJS על Node.js, FastAPI על Python, או Chi/Gin על Go. מפרט OpenAPI מניע את התיעוד, יצירת הקוד והבדיקות. ה-APIs נפרסים על Vercel, AWS, או Kubernetes עם תצורת API gateway מתאימה.
לצוותים הבונים APIs פונים לציבור עבור שותפים ומפתחים, APIs פנימיים המחברים microservices, או B2B APIs לאינטגרציות מוצרים. אנו מספקים REST APIs העוקבים אחר סטנדרטים, בעלי ביצועים טובים, ומספקים חווית מפתחים מעולה.
מודל משאבים, הגדרת נקודות קצה (endpoints), מודל אימות, אסטרטגיית חלוקה לעמודים (pagination), ומוסכמות שגיאה.
כתיבת מפרט OpenAPI, הגדרת סכימות, הגדרת שרת mock, ואימות התכנון עם הצרכנים.
יישום נקודות קצה (endpoints), אימות, אימות בקשות (validation), הגבלת קצב (rate limiting), ולוגיקה עסקית.
כתיבת בדיקות אינטגרציה, יצירת תיעוד אינטראקטיבי, ויצירת מדריכי התחלה מהירה.
פריסה (Deploy), הגדרת ניטור ואנליטיקה, פרסום תיעוד, ושילוב צרכני API ראשונים.
בואו נבנה REST API שמפתחים אוהבים — מעוצב היטב, מתועד היטב, ואמין.
אנו בונים REST API באמצעות Node.js עם Express או Fastify, Python עם FastAPI או Django REST Framework, Go עם Gin, ו-.NET Web API. אנו בוחרים את הסטאק בהתבסס על דרישות הביצועים שלכם, מומחיות הצוות וצרכי המערכת האקולוגית.
MicrocosmWorks מציעה פיתוח REST API ב-$15-$45 לשעה. העלויות תלויות במספר ה-endpoints, מורכבות האימות, דרישות ה-rate limiting, ושילוב עם שירותים חיצוניים.
כן, אנו מיישמים ניהול גרסאות של API באמצעות נתיב URL או כותרות, מייצרים אוטומטית תיעוד OpenAPI/Swagger, משתמשים בפורמטים עקביים לתגובות שגיאה, ועוקבים אחר עקרונות HATEOAS היכן שמתאים לצורך גילוי.
בהחלט. אנו מיישמים OAuth2 עם אסימוני JWT, בקרת גישה מבוססת תפקידים ובקרת גישה מבוססת מאפיינים, ניהול מפתחות API, הגבלת קצב בקשות לכל לקוח, והרשאות מבוססות היקף כדי לאבטח את נקודות הקצה של ה-REST API שלכם.
אנו מיישמים cursor-based pagination עבור תוצאות עקביות, סינון גמיש עם query parameters, sparse fieldsets כדי להפחית את גודל ה-payload, ו-ETag-based caching כדי למזער את השימוש ברוחב הפס ב-endpoints נגישים בתדירות גבוהה.